What is the name of the membrane that delimits the nucleus? To which component of the cell structure that membrane is contiguous?
Answer / Yasho Verma
The nuclear membrane, also known as the nuclear envelope, separates the nucleus from the cytoplasm. It consists of two concentric lipid bilayers with perforations called nuclear pores, which allow for the exchange of molecules between the nucleus and the cytoplasm.
